Novel rapid, sensitive, and simple detection assays that can be routinely used to prevent the transmission of Salmonella in the pork industry are in high-demand. Reverse-transcriptase Loop-mediated isothermal Amplification (RT-LAMP) assay is a novel molecular method that has advantages over real-time reversetranscriptase Polymerase Chain Reaction (RT-PCR) in that it does not require expensive equipment such as a realtime PCR machine as the reaction occurs in a waterbath at one temperature and detection is by turbidity or fluorescence after 2 h. The objectives of this research were to develop and apply novel assays such as RT-LAMP and RT-PCR to pork products and the pork environment for the rapid and sensitive detection of Salmonella Typhimurium and for comparison to traditional cultural methods. Another objective was to apply the RT-LAMP assay to detect Salmonella from pork products obtained from grocery stores and from pork processing facilities to test the suitability of the novel assays for routine testing by the pork industry in real-world scenarios.
